No DataZainapora district is divided into several Subdivision or tehsils for administrative convenience. There are 14 villages in Zainapora Subdivision. The following is a list of villages in Zainapora Subdivision.
| # | Villages | Gram Panchayat |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Aglar Chirat | Aglar |
| 2 | Awneera | Awneera |
| 3 | Baba Pora | Babapora |
| 4 | Cheer Marg | Cheermarg |
| 5 | Durpora | Babapora |
| 6 | Mailhora | Melhura |
| 7 | Muja Marg | Cheermarg |
| 8 | Nadi Marg | Cheermarg |
| 9 | Rakh Zain Pora | Zainapora |
| 10 | Safanagri | Safanagri |
| 11 | Sofi Pora | Sofipora |
| 12 | Wachi | Wachi B |
| 13 | Wachi | Watchi A |
| 14 | Zain Pora | Zainapora |
